Enhancing Your Solar Project: Exploring Solar Panel Mounting Systems

When it comes to solar panel installations, choosing the right mounting system is crucial for optimal performance and long-term success. Various mounting options, such as canopy mounts, ground mounts, rooftop mounts, and pole mounts, offer unique benefits and applications tailored to different project needs. In this blog, we will delve into the advantages of different solar panel mounting systems and discuss the conveniences of each system.

1. Canopy Mount

Canopy mount systems involve installing solar panels on structures like carports, pergolas, or overhead canopies. The benefits of canopy mounts include:

  • Utilizing underutilized space: Canopy mounts allow for dual-purpose functionality, providing shade and protection while generating solar energy.
  • Efficient land use: By utilizing existing structures, canopy mounts are an excellent option for projects with limited ground space.
  • Enhanced aesthetics: Canopy mounts offer a visually appealing solution, seamlessly integrating solar panels into architectural designs.
  • Solar canopy systems can offset a significant portion of the energy consumed by EV charging stations. The solar panels generate electricity during the day, which can be utilized to power the charging stations, reducing the reliance on grid electricity. This leads to cost savings for both the charging station operators and EV owners, making electric vehicle usage more economical.

2. Ground Mount

Ground mount systems involve installing solar panels directly on the ground, typically in open areas or fields. The advantages of ground mounts include:

  • Flexibility in orientation and tilt: Ground mounts can be customized to maximize solar exposure based on location and energy production goals.
  • Easy access for maintenance: Ground-mounted systems provide convenient access for cleaning, maintenance, and repairs.
  • Scalability: Ground mounts can accommodate larger solar arrays, making them suitable for commercial and utility-scale projects.

3. Rooftop Mount

Rooftop mount systems involve installing solar panels on rooftops of residential, commercial, or industrial buildings. The benefits of rooftop mounts include:

  • Utilizing available roof space: Rooftop mounts make efficient use of existing structures and reduce the need for additional land.
  • Reduced installation time and cost: Rooftop installations often have simplified permitting and wiring processes compared to ground-based systems.
  • Energy self-consumption: Rooftop mounts are well-suited for customers seeking to offset their electricity usage and maximize energy self-sufficiency.

4. Pole Mount

Pole mount systems involve installing solar panels on poles or single-axis trackers that follow the sun’s path. The advantages of pole mounts include:

  • Enhanced solar tracking: Pole mounts can optimize energy production by tracking the sun’s movement throughout the day.
  • Flexibility in positioning: Pole mounts can be installed in various locations, including open fields, parking lots, or remote areas.
  • Reduced shading: By elevating the panels, pole mounts minimize shading issues and maximize solar exposure.
